Christmas is celebrated by Russians in Uzbekistan on 7 January, as in all Orthodox countries using the Julian calendar. There are no special events in the cities, as most Russians left Uzbekistan after the independence. Nevertheless, if you meet Russian families who stayed in the steppe, you can attend the Orthodox Christmas rite and taste the famous koutia: a mixture of wheat, honey and poppy seeds, traditionally cooked for the occasion.
